In Spanish you usually say you will finish a task in/on "tiempo y forma" but how do you translate this phrase into English? ("On/in time and schedule/agenda"?).
Thank you in advance.
A.
Top answer
"tiempo y forma" = "in due time and proper form". "within the allowed time period and following the legal formalities/procedures".
